### Step 6 — Push to the Gateway

Once the AgriLink telemetry build passes the bench test on the FieldNode rig, package it with the bundler and tag the version. The gateway at the Dorrel test farm only accepts signed bundles. Use the deploy key below when prompted by the uploader.

deploy key for kajof-fajop: bky6_gDHw9Q

Welcome to the Parcelhop webhook crew! Our tracking-event webhook fires whenever a parcel changes state in the Driftline courier feed. For review purposes, spin up the local receiver with `make webhook-dev` and replay fixtures from the events/samples folder. Signatures are HMAC over the raw body, so don't pretty-print before verifying. The staging receiver authenticates with the key below.

service key, fawip-bajef: kto11_Qt5wZK9vdNC

## Alert: StatRelay Sidecar Flush Lag

This alert fires when the StatRelay metrics-aggregation sidecar falls more than 120 seconds behind on flushing buffered samples to the Coalmine backend. Plugin-emitted counters are buffered in-process, so sustained lag usually means a plugin is emitting unbounded label cardinality or blocking the flush thread. Check your plugin's metric registration against the published cardinality limits before escalating. If the lag persists after your plugin is ruled out, contact the telemetry team.

escalation mailbox, bagug-fahof: novdor.wendor.jormir@norvalabs.example